Don't live in Australia but can certainly comment on the process for buying DVC while living abroad
![]() A lot of this depends on whether DVC is legally licensed (not sure if "licensed" is the best word, but you get my point hopefully ) to sell memberships to the country where the prospective buyer lives. To find out whether this is the case or not, you can simply to go the DVC website and request information. When you go to the request information screen, there's a drop-down list for country. If your country is listed, then DVC can sell to you directly.Assuming DVC is able to sell to the foreign country where you live, then it's quite simple. You request information DVC, or call them. Tell them what you want to buy, and after they gather all the information, they'll simply send you all the forms to your address abroad. You can pay by credit card for simplicity. If DVC is not able to sell to the foreign country where you live, then DVC won't be able to send anything to you, not even promotional brochures. In this case, you can only purchase a membership while you are in the states at a DVC sales center (or I guess they also have sales center in Japan, so not necessarily in the states...). All paperwork has to be done while you're there as again, DVC can't mail anything related to the sales to your foreign address. You will complete your purchase in WDW (most likely), and bring everything back with you. You can then call back to pay the remaining balance. Hope this helps!

I'm in the Netherlands where DVC is not allowed to sell either, I bought resale via Time Share Store.
Saved money and bought when it was convenient for us. Did not want to spend the time on it during our vacations. |
